Advanced Hybrid Powertrain
At the heart of the 2026 Highlander is Toyota’s latest hybrid powertrain, combining a petrol engine with an electric motor to deliver a smooth, responsive, and fuel-efficient driving experience. The hybrid system intelligently switches between electric and petrol modes, optimizing energy use depending on driving conditions.
The result is impressive fuel efficiency without compromising on power or acceleration. Low-speed city driving benefits from electric-only operation, reducing fuel consumption and emissions, while the petrol engine provides stable power for highway cruising. This balance ensures that the Highlander is both eco-friendly and capable, making it suitable for diverse driving conditions.

Safety and Driver Assistance
Toyota has prioritized safety in the 2026 Highlander, equipping the SUV with a comprehensive suite of standard and advanced safety features. Multiple airbags, anti-lock braking, electronic stability control, and traction control ensure basic protection for all occupants.
Advanced driver assistance systems include adaptive cruise control, lane-keeping assist, blind-spot monitoring, rear cross-traffic alert, and automatic emergency braking. These systems help reduce the risk of accidents, enhance driver confidence, and provide peace of mind, especially for families traveling with children or in challenging driving conditions.
